Just remember he missed almost a whole day of eating and the diarrhea was probably food left over in his intestines before you stopped feeding him. Just keep an eye on him as he knows something hurts back there but he doesn't know what. With the 20 plus dogs that have been spayed or neutered I never had a problem with constipation.

Yes he could poop in them so you have to watch him. Now if you have to leave him at home then you will have to get an ecollar that fits him. I was lucky as I work from home so I never used either and kept them in my office so they didn't lick.
